Farrowing crates - how you can help

2nd Sep 2019 / By Rebecca Veale

A debate is taking place on 9 September 2019 on the ‘end the cage age’ petition that has been circulated by Green NGOs and we are asking members to contact their MP to ensure they have the facts ahead of the debate.

Part of this campaign is calling for Defra to ban the use of farrowing crates and the petition has over 100k signatures from the public. A template letter was sent with Piggy Points which can be updated and amended to share the impact such a ban would have on your business. The NPA briefing on Farrowing Crates is a good document which explains in more detail what and why we use farrowing crates, this is something you may want to include with your letter or email.


How you can help…

  1. Use the template letter and amend it where necessary for your business or circumstances.

  2. Send the letter (attaching the NPA briefing) to your MP – if you are unsure who your MP is or how to contact them, you can find their details by putting in your postcode here.

  3. Keep the NPA posted if you hear back from your MP.


The NPA has highlighted why farrowing crates are so important and will continue to do so as the debate approaches, but we need as many members to rally to this as possible – a future ban could be a real possibility, especially with the current Defra Ministerial team in place. 

We are fully supportive of those who wish to move in this direction and continue to look for Government financial support to allow it, but do not believe that a ban is the right way forward.
